Improve Build a Frog Docs with Gifs and Webpage!

Open keenanjohnson opened this issue 1 year ago • 0 comments

During the recent corporate event for Ribbit, we quickly created this set of Frog Sensor Instructions on Squarespace which greatly improved the "build a frog sensor" experience.

The main benefits:

  • Instructions were hosted as a dedicated web page that rendered well on mobile
  • Instructions included a lot of awesome Gifs.

Downsides:

  • Hosting the instructions on Squarespace is not ideal as it creates a "walled garden" meaning only those with access can submit fixes and we loose a lot of the benefits of being an open-source project.

I believe and think that we should reconcile this set of instructions with the set of instructions we have on Github.

It's possible to host a set of instructions on github that render into a nice webpage.

My main inspiration is https://docs.opulo.io/

They host docs from here: https://github.com/opulo-inc/docs/tree/main using a tool called Material for MkDocs

I believe we should port the gifs and content from the Squarespace into a version of the docs using Material for MkDocs.
